根据提供的问答内容,我将尝试给出完善且全面的答案。
这个问答内容涉及到数据库操作中的条件判断和数据删除操作。具体来说,问题描述了一种情况:如果不存在满足条件的记录,则执行插入操作;如果存在满足条件的记录,则执行更新操作;如果不是数字,则执行删除操作。
针对这个问题,可以使用SQL语言来实现相应的操作。下面是一个示例的SQL语句:
IF NOT EXISTS (SELECT * FROM 表名 WHERE 条件)
INSERT INTO 表名 (列名1, 列名2, ...) VALUES (值1, 值2, ...)
ELSE IF EXISTS (SELECT * FROM 表名 WHERE 条件)
UPDATE 表名 SET 列名1 = 值1, 列名2 = 值2, ... WHERE 条件
ELSE IF NOT ISNUMERIC(列名)
DELETE FROM 表名 WHERE 条件
这个SQL语句中,需要替换的部分包括:
这个SQL语句的执行逻辑如下:
需要注意的是,这个SQL语句只是一个示例,具体的实现方式可能会根据具体的数据库系统和表结构而有所不同。
关于数据库操作和条件判断,腾讯云提供了多个相关产品和服务,例如:
以上是对于问题的回答,希望能够满足您的需求。如果还有其他问题,请随时提问。
领取专属 10元无门槛券
手把手带您无忧上云